Fuel System Cautions
CAUTION!
Follow these guidelines to maintain your vehicle’s performance:
•The use of leaded gas is prohibited by Federal law. Using
leaded gasoline can impair engine performance, damage the
emission control system.
•An out-of-tune engine, or certain fuel or ignition malfunctions,
can cause the catalytic converter to overheat. If you notice a
pungent burning odor or some light smoke, your engine may
be out of tune or malfunctioning and may require immediate
service. Contact your dealer for service assistance.
•When pulling a heavy load or driving a fully loaded vehicle
when the humidity is low and the temperature is high, use a
premium unleaded fuel to help prevent spark knock. If spark
knock persists, lighten the load, or engine piston damage may
result.
•The use of fuel additives which are now being sold as octane
enhancers is not recommended. Many of these products con-
tain high concentrations of methanol. Fuel system damage or
vehicle performance problems resulting from the use of such
fuels or additives is not the responsibility of the manufacturer.
NOTE:Intentional tampering with emissions control
systems can result in civil penalties being assessed
against you.

Carbon Monoxide Warnings
WARNING!
Carbon monoxide (CO) in exhaust gases is deadly. Follow the
precautions below to prevent carbon monoxide poisoning:
•Do not inhale exhaust gases. They contain carbon monox-
ide, a colorless and odorless gas which can kill. Never run
the engine in a closed area, such as a garage, and never sit
in a parked vehicle with the engine running for an
extended period. If the vehicle is stopped in an open area
with the engine running for more than a short period,
adjust the ventilation system to force fresh, outside air into
the vehicle.
•Guard against carbon monoxide with proper maintenance.
Have the exhaust system inspected every time the vehicle
is raised. Have any abnormal conditions repaired
promptly. Until repaired, drive with all side windows fully
open.
•Keep the liftgate closed when driving your vehicle to
prevent carbon monoxide and other poisonous exhaust
gases from entering the vehicle.
CATALYTIC CONVERTER
The catalytic converter requires the use of unleaded fuel
only. Leaded gasoline will destroy the effectiveness of the
catalyst as an emission control device. Under normal
operating conditions, the catalytic converter will not
require maintenance. However, you must keep the en-
gine maintained to assure proper operation and prevent
possible damage.
NOTE:Intentional tampering with emissions control
systems can result in civil penalties being assessed
against you.
266 STARTING AND OPERATING
Page 267 of 416

CAUTION!
Damage to the catalytic converter can result if your
vehicle is not kept in proper operating condition. In
the event of engine malfunction, particularly involv-
ing engine misfire or other apparent loss of perfor-
mance, have your vehicle serviced promptly. Contin-
ued operation of your vehicle with a severe
malfunction could cause the converter to overheat,
resulting in possible damage to the converter and
vehicle.
As with any vehicle, do not park or operate this vehicle in
areas where combustible materials such as grass or leaves
can come in contact with a hot exhaust system.
A scorching odor may be detected if you continue to run
a malfunctioning engine. The odor may indicate severe
and abnormal catalyst overheating. If this occurs, thevehicle should be stopped, the engine shut off and the
vehicle allowed to cool. Service, including a tune-up to
manufacturer’s specifications should be obtained imme-
diately.
To minimize the possibility of catalyst damage:
•Do not try to start the engine by pushing or towing the
vehicle.
•Do not idle the engine with any spark plug wires
disconnected or removed.
•Do not idle the engine for prolonged periods during
very rough idle or malfunctioning operating condi-
tions.
•Do not allow vehicle to run out of fuel.

VEHICLE LOADING
Certification Label
As required by National Highway Traffic Safety Admin-
istration Regulations, your vehicle has a certification
label affixed to the driver’s side door.
This label contains the month and year of manufacture,
Gross Vehicle Weight Rating (GVWR), Gross Axle WeightRating (GAWR) front and rear, and Vehicle Identification
Number (VIN). A Month-Day-Hour (MDH) number is
included on this label and shows the Month, Day, and
Hour of manufacture. The bar code that appears on the
bottom of the label is your Vehicle Identification Number
(VIN).
Gross Vehicle Weight Rating (GVWR)
The GVWR is the total permissible weight of your vehicle
including driver, passengers, vehicle, options, and cargo.
The label also specifies maximum capacities of front and
rear axle systems. Total load must be limited so that
GVWR is not exceeded.
Payload
The payload of a vehicle is defined as the allowable load
weight a truck can carry including the weight of the
driver, all passengers, options, and cargo.

Gross Axle Weight Rating (GAWR)
The GAWR is the maximum permissible load on the front
and rear axles. The load must be distributed in the cargo
area so that the GAWR of each axle is not exceeded.
Each axle GAWR is determined by the component in the
system with the lowest load carrying capacity (axle,
springs, tires, or wheels).
Heavier axles or suspension components sometimes
specified by purchasers for increased durability do not
necessarily increase the vehicle’s GVWR.
Tire Size
This is the minimum allowable tire size for your vehicle.
Replacement tires must be equal to the load capacity of
this tire size.
Rim Size
This is the rim size that is appropriate for the tire size
listed.
Inflation Pressure (Cold)
This is the cold tire inflation pressure for your vehicle for
all loading conditions up to full GAWR.
Curb Weight
The curb weight of a vehicle is defined as the total weight
of the vehicle with all fluids, including vehicle fuel, at full
capacity conditions, and with no occupants or cargo
loaded into the vehicle. The front and rear curb weight
values are determined by weighing your vehicle on a
commercial scale before any occupants or cargo are
added.
Loading
The actual total weight and the weight of the front and
rear of your vehicle at the ground can best be determined
by weighing it when it is loaded and ready for operation.
The entire vehicle should first be weighed on a commer-
cial scale to insure that the GVWR has not been exceeded.
The weight on the front and rear of the vehicle should

then be determined separately to be sure that the load is
properly distributed over front and rear axle. Weighing
the vehicle may show that the GAWR of either the front
or rear axles has been exceeded but the total load is
within the specified GVWR. If so, weight must be shifted
from front to rear or rear to front as appropriate until the
specified weight limitations are met.
Store heavier items down low and be sure that the weight
is distributed equally. Stow all loose items securely before
driving.
Improper weight distribution can have an adverse effect
on the way your vehicle steers and handles and the way
the brakes operate.WARNING!
Do not load your vehicle any heavier than the
GVWR or the maximum front and rear GAWR. If
you do, parts on your vehicle can break, or it can
change the way your vehicle handles. This could
cause you to lose control. Also, overloading can
shorten the life of your vehicle.
A loaded vehicle is shown in the following example. Note
that neither GVWR nor GAWR capabilities are exceeded.
Overloading can cause potential safety hazards and
shorten service life.

Definitions
The following trailer towing related terminology defini-
tions will assist in understanding the subsequent sec-
tions:
GROSS COMBINATION WEIGHT RATING (GCWR)
is the total permissible weight of your vehicle and trailer
when weighed in combination. (Note that GCWR ratings
include a 68 kg (150 lb.) allowance for the presence of a
driver.) Tongue Weight (of a trailer) is the weight placed
on a vehicle’s trailer hitch by the trailer.
GROSS TRAILER WEIGHT (GTW)is the weight of the
trailer plus the weight of all cargo, consumables and
equipment (permanent or temporary) loaded in or on the
trailer in itsloaded and ready for operationcondition.

TRAILER SWAY CONTROLis a telescoping link that
can be installed between the hitch receiver and the trailer
tongue that typically provides adjustable friction associ-
ated with the telescoping motion to dampen any un-
wanted trailer swaying motions while traveling.
CAUTION!
•During the first 500 miles (805 km) your new
vehicle is driven, do not tow a trailer. Doing so
may damage your vehicle.
•When first towing a trailer, limit your speed to 50
mph (80 km/h) during the first 500 miles (805 km)
of towing.
Perform the maintenance listed in Section 8 of this
manual. When towing a trailer, never exceed the GAWR,
or GCWR, ratings.Consider the following items when computing the
weight on the rear axle:
•The tongue weight of the trailer.
•The weight of any other type of cargo or equipment
put in or on your vehicle.
